Found this in the a4 b9 forum:
1. Turn on the ignition but don’t start the car.
2. Turn off start/stop
3. Turn off the MMI
4. Turn off the heating/AC
5. Wait a minute after all of that then plug in the dongle

You’ll see flashing red and green lights, you’ll get error messages on you VC then after a few minutes the green LED on the dongle will stay on with no red.

6. Turn the car off.
7. Unplug the dongle
They don't have the A6 C8 listed on their site though so I hope it works and doesn't mess anything up...
